Kit and caboodle

I record most of my visits to historic sites with a Canon EOS 350D digital camera. At one time I lugged around a kit bag with three 35mm camera bodies loaded with 100ASA, 400ASA and either slide or B&W film. Add in wide-angle, standard 50mm, macro zoom, telephoto and 500mm mirror lenses plus flash, filters etc and it's no surprise that I had back-ache. Now I can get along with the Canon digital plus three lenses in a bag a quarter the size and a fraction of the weight. The quality of image, as in this photo of an iris, is still very acceptable.
